When it comes to search engine optimization (SEO) tools, Ahrefs, Semrush, and Moz are three of the most popular and comprehensive options available. Each of these platforms offers a robust set of features to help marketers research keywords, analyze backlinks, track rankings, and improve their overall SEO strategy. But how do they compare, and which one is the best choice for your needs? This in-depth comparison will examine the key features, strengths, and weaknesses of Ahrefs, Semrush, and Moz to help you determine which tool is right for you.
Before diving into the detailed comparison, let's start with a quick overview of each platform:
Ahrefs is best known for its powerful backlink analysis capabilities. Over the years, it has expanded to offer a full suite of SEO tools including keyword research, rank tracking, site audits, and content research.
Semrush began as a competitor research tool but has grown into an all-in-one marketing platform. In addition to SEO features, it offers tools for content marketing, social media, PPC advertising, and more.
Moz was one of the first SEO software companies and is known for developing metrics like Domain Authority. It provides a comprehensive set of SEO research and analysis tools.
Now let's compare how these three tools stack up in some key areas:
Keyword research is a critical component of any SEO strategy. All three tools offer robust keyword research capabilities, but with some key differences:
Ahrefs provides extensive keyword data through its Keywords Explorer tool. Some standout features include:
Semrush offers the Keyword Magic Tool which boasts an enormous database of over 20 billion keywords. Key features include:
Moz provides keyword research through its Keyword Explorer. Highlights include:
Overall, Semrush tends to offer the most comprehensive keyword data, while Ahrefs excels at providing actionable metrics like click potential. Moz's keyword tools are solid but not quite as extensive as the other two.
Analyzing backlink profiles is crucial for understanding a site's authority and uncovering link building opportunities. This is an area where Ahrefs really shines:
Ahrefs is widely considered to have the largest and most frequently updated backlink index. Key backlink features include:
Semrush offers solid backlink analysis capabilities through its Backlink Analytics tool:
Moz provides backlink data via its Link Explorer:
While all three tools offer strong backlink analysis features, Ahrefs is generally considered the leader in this area due to its comprehensive index and powerful link metrics.
Monitoring keyword rankings is essential for measuring SEO progress. Here's how the rank tracking capabilities compare:
Ahrefs offers rank tracking through its Rank Tracker tool:
Semrush provides robust rank tracking via its Position Tracking tool:
Moz offers rank tracking as part of Moz Pro:
Semrush stands out for offering daily rank updates by default, while Ahrefs and Moz typically update weekly on lower-tier plans. Semrush and Moz also have an edge when it comes to local rank tracking capabilities.
Technical SEO audits help identify on-site issues that may be impacting rankings. All three tools offer site audit functionality:
Ahrefs provides a Site Audit tool that crawls your site to find over 100 common SEO issues:
Semrush offers an extensive Site Audit tool:
Moz includes a Site Crawl feature in Moz Pro:
Semrush tends to offer the most comprehensive site audit capabilities, but all three tools provide solid technical SEO analysis features.
Analyzing competitor strategies is crucial for staying ahead in SEO. Here's how the competitor research tools compare:
Ahrefs offers several competitor analysis features:
Semrush provides extensive competitor analysis capabilities:
Moz includes some competitor analysis tools:
Semrush offers the most comprehensive set of competitor analysis features, especially when it comes to estimating traffic and market share. Ahrefs provides powerful domain-level analysis, while Moz's competitor tools are more limited compared to the other two.
Pricing is an important consideration when choosing an SEO tool. Here's a quick overview of the pricing tiers for each platform:
Ahrefs:
Semrush:
Moz:
Ahrefs and Moz have similar entry-level pricing, while Semrush is slightly more expensive. However, Semrush tends to offer more features at each tier. All three tools offer annual discounts and custom enterprise plans.
While there is significant overlap in functionality, each tool has some unique strengths that set it apart:
Ahrefs:
Semrush:
Moz:
The best SEO tool for you will depend on your specific needs and budget. Here are some recommendations:
Choose Ahrefs if:
Choose Semrush if:
Choose Moz if:
Ultimately, all three tools are powerful options that can significantly boost your SEO efforts. Many marketers choose to use a combination of tools to get the best of each platform. Most offer free trials, so it's worth testing them out to see which one best fits your workflow and needs.
By leveraging the strengths of Ahrefs, Semrush, or Moz, you'll be well-equipped to improve your search engine rankings, drive more organic traffic, and stay ahead of the competition in the ever-evolving world of SEO.
Citations: [1] https://www.semrush.com/features/ [2] https://moz.com/products/pro [3] https://www.contentpowered.com/blog/semrush-ahrefs-moz-guide/ [4] https://www.forbes.com/advisor/business/software/semrush-review/ [5] https://shanebarker.com/blog/semrush-vs-moz-vs-ahrefs/ [6] https://www.stylefactoryproductions.com/blog/ahrefs-vs-moz-vs-semrush [7] https://www.99signals.com/best-semrush-features/ [8] https://www.seo.com/tools/semrush-vs-ahrefs/ [9] https://backlinko.com/ahrefs-vs-semrush [10] https://www.forbes.com/advisor/in/business/software/ahrefs-review/ [11] https://ahrefs.com/blog/unique-features-ahrefs/ [12] https://ahrefs.com/vs [13] https://www.seo.com/tools/moz/